User Tools

Site Tools


workflows

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
Last revisionBoth sides next revision
workflows [2018/07/10 11:54] – [Autodetect humeral elevation phases] oliverworkflows [2018/07/10 11:57] – [Autodetect humeral elevation phases] oliver
Line 14: Line 14:
  
  
 +<code xml> 
 + <Phase name="REleStartPhase"  
 +           process="post" minwidth="10" 
 +           startEvent="RHS" endEvent="RTO" 
 +           includes="ShoulderAbdAdd,ShoulderAnteRetro">RShoulderEleDepHDCalDirCosAngle &lt; 30.0</Phase> 
 +        <Event name="REleStart" phase="REleStartPhase" method="min" 
 +               includes="ShoulderAbdAdd,ShoulderAnteRetro" process="post">RShoulderEleDepHDCalDirCosAngle*1.0</Event> 
 +        <!-- die 40 hat sich bei RCycleMaxElevation=90 bewaehrt, bei cylcMaxElevation=60 muss das vielleicht um 10 reduziert werden --> 
 +        <Phase name="REleEndPhase"  
 +           process="post" minwidth="40" 
 +           startEvent="RHS" endEvent="RTO" 
 +           includes="ShoulderAbdAdd,ShoulderAnteRetro">RShoulderEleDepHDCalDirCosAngle &gt; (RCycleMaxElevation - 30.0)</Phase> 
 +        <Event name="REleEnd" phase="REleEndPhase" method="max" 
 +               includes="ShoulderAbdAdd,ShoulderAnteRetro" process="post">RShoulderEleDepHDCalDirCosAngle*1.0</Event>  
 +            
 +        <!-- WORKAROUND if singularities occures, show a smaller phase without them for testing --> 
 +        <!--Phase name="RSHRPhase" 
 +           startEvent="REleStart" endEvent="REleEnd" process="post"  
 +           contiguous="false" 
 +           includes="ShoulderAbdAdd">(RShoulderEleDepHDCalDirCosAngle &gt; (RCycleMaxElevation - 30.0)) &amp;&amp; (RShoulderEleDepHDCalDirCosAngle &lt; RCycleMaxElevation)</Phase--> 
 +               
 +        <!-- RShoulderEleDepHDCalDirCosAngle &lt; RCycleMaxElevation --> 
 +        <!-- limit always to 90 degree instead to RCycleMaxElevatio--> 
 +        <Phase name="RElePhase"  
 +           startEvent="REleStart" endEvent="REleEnd" process="post"  
 +           contiguous="false" 
 +           includes="ShoulderAbdAdd,ShoulderAnteRetro">RShoulderEleDepHDCalDirCosAngle &lt; 90.0</Phase> 
 +</code>
  
  
workflows.txt · Last modified: 2018/07/10 12:02 by oliver